Would anyone be able to give pros and cons of the Madrillon Farms neighborhood for a family w/ elem.-age kids? Looking there as we love that it is walking distance from the school and the townhouses are lovely and in our budget.

Also, are there similar nearby Vienna neighborhoods you could recommend? Thanks so much.

Pros include proximity to both Tysons Corner and Town of Vienna; most of the construction in the immediate area is new and up-scale; and the factors you've mentioned (in addition to the elementary school, the middle school, Kilmer, is also very close).

Cons include lots of traffic congestion around Tysons; residential areas are close to office parks on Gallows; and there's not as much green space as there might have been had some of the developers not bulldozed everything in sight before starting to build).

There are some similar townhouse neighborhoods near the corner of Old Courthouse and Route 123 in Vienna; one is called Westwood Towns. They are also near busy Tysons/Vienna intersections, but there aren't as many office parks close by as at Madrillon. The local school is Westbriar ES, rather than Freedom Hill ES; some of the elementary school students in these townhouse complexes walk, and others ride the bus.

I hope I didn't come across as suggesting it's not a safe area. While I think it's somewhat congested, it's also quite safe and parents seem to like Freedom Hill ES a lot. A SFH in that area that was recently listed for about $900K went under contract within a week.
